| Product Overview |
|---|
The Fujitsu Quad-Ports RJ-45 Gigabit Ethernet PCI Express adapter delivers reliable multi-port network connectivity for servers. It fits into PCIe 2.1 x4 slots and supports standard Ethernet speeds, making it a practical choice for systems that need several high-speed network interfaces in one card. |

| Technical Information | |
|---|---|
| Chipset/Controller | Intel I350-AM4 |
| Virtualization Support | SR-IOV, VMDq, NetQueue |
| Data Rate (Speed) | 1GbE |
| Data Center Bridging | No |
| Storage Over Ethernet | iSCSI |
| Interface (Bus) | PCIe 2.0 x4 |
| Number of Ports | 4-Port (Quad) |
| OS Compatibility | Windows Server 2022, VMware ESXi 8.0, RHEL |
| Network Management | SNMP, RMON |
| Offload Support | iSCSI, PXE Boot, Wake-on-LAN (WoL), TCP Stateless Offload, Jumbo Frames |

| Product Description |
|---|
This Fujitsu network adapter provides four Gigabit Ethernet ports, enabling high-speed wired connections for servers and enterprise systems. It's commonly used in data centers and server rooms where multiple network links are necessary for redundancy or load balancing. Built for IT professionals managing network infrastructure, this adapter helps maintain stable and efficient data transfer across networks. Its PCI Express 2.1 x4 interface ensures compatibility and bandwidth to handle demanding server workloads. Key Features
This adapter typically appears in enterprise servers where network uptime and performance are critical. It's well-suited for applications like virtualization, storage networking, and heavy data processing environments. By providing multiple Gigabit Ethernet ports, it offers flexibility in network design and improves fault tolerance for server connections. |
